Quick Summary
Beware is a moody, 1970s-set horror experience that centers on a small, tense scenario: the player spends most of the game sitting inside a car after being forced off the road, waiting in the dark for assistance while unsettling events unfold around them. The concept is strong and the atmosphere often succeeds at building dread, but technical problems can interrupt the experience for players who play beyond a brief session.
Setting and Core Loop
- Period detail and lighting design evoke the late 1970s effectively.
- Much of the gameplay is confined to the interior of a stalled vehicle as you wait for help, which intensifies the claustrophobic feel.
- Sound design and pacing are used to gradually ratchet up unease.
- The scenario is intentionally slow-burn, relying on mood rather than frequent action.
Reliability and Playability
- The game shows clear potential, but persistent bugs appear for many players after a short time.
- Crashes, scripting errors, and odd behaviors can break immersion and halt progress.
- Some of the problems are minor visual or audio hiccups; others may require restarting or reloading saves.
- Patch support or updates will be important for a smoother experience.
Who Might Enjoy It
- Players who appreciate atmospheric, psychological horror and focused, minimal scenarios.
- Those looking for a short, tense experience rather than long-form survival mechanics.
- Fans of slow-building dread will likely have the strongest response.
- If technical stability is a must for you, this one may feel frustrating.
